Little Mix’s BRITs drinking plan for Rihanna


Little Mix plan on getting Rihanna drunk at the BRITs so she’ll agree to collaborate with them.

The girl group – who have two nominations for British Single and British Artist Video of the Year for their hit ‘Black Magic’ – are desperate to work with the R&B superstar and singers Perrie Edwards and Jade Thirlwall have a cunning plan to ply the Bajan beauty with booze so she’ll sing on a track with them.

Jade, 23, revealed the plan worked with dance duo Sigma, who now want to work with the foursome after sharing some drinks with them.

Perrie, 22, gushed: "Could you imagine if we just went up to Rihanna and were like, ‘Do you fancy doing a tune with us?’ That would be amazing."

Remembering how the girls cornered Sigma, Jade told the Daily Star newspaper: "It’s better when they are drunk. I was drunk talking to Sigma and they would love to work with us soon."

And bandmate Jesy Nelson – who is engaged to Rixton’s Jake Roche – agreed to the plan, she added: "That’s sick. That’s what we need to do."

However, they might have a big job on their hands trying to get time with RiRi, as when they were on ‘The X Factor’ in 2012 with the R&B superstar her management banned anyone from speaking to her.

Leigh-Anne Pinnock, 24, said: "Her management wouldn’t let anybody meet her, but she walked past me and said, ‘Your hair is awesome!’ This was when I had my head half-shaved, which I hated, so it cheered me up."

Little Mix and Rihanna are both set to perform at the BRIT Awards 2016 with MasterCard at The O2 in London on February 24.
